ASUS P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I Pro WS TRX50-SAGE WIFI CEB Workstation Motherboard

Overview

The ASUS P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I is a CEB-form-factor workstation motherboard built around AMD's Socket sTR5 platform, designed to carry AMD Ryzen Threadripper PRO 7000 WX-Series processors into demanding professional compute environments — think multi-GPU rendering nodes, large-model inference workstations, and high-throughput data-pipeline machines. If you're sizing a workstation that needs to outlast its CPU generation without a platform swap, the TRX50 socket and DDR5 ECC foundation here give you a credible runway. The P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I (often searched as PROWSTRX50 SAGEWIFI) ships with WiFi 7 and dual LAN — 10 Gb and 2.5 Gb — so network connectivity won't be your bottleneck whether you're on a wired backbone or a high-density wireless segment.

Key Features

  • Socket sTR5 — AMD Threadripper PRO 7000 WX Support: The sTR5 socket is AMD's current high-core-count workstation platform. Pairing it with Threadripper PRO 7000 WX-Series CPUs means access to up to 96 cores with workstation-class memory and I/O bandwidth — relevant if your workloads are CPU-bound at scale (simulation, rendering, large dataset processing).
  • Quad-Channel DDR5 ECC up to 1 TB: Four DIMM slots in quad-channel DDR5 configuration support up to 1 TB of ECC R-DIMM memory. ECC catches single-bit memory errors in flight — essential for financial modeling, scientific compute, or any workload where a silent data corruption event is unacceptable. 1 TB addressable memory eliminates in-memory dataset size as a bottleneck for most professional applications.
  • PCIe 5.0 x16 Expansion: PCIe 5.0 doubles the per-lane bandwidth of Gen 4 — each x16 slot delivers up to 128 GB/s bidirectional throughput. Multi-GPU deployments benefit directly: GPU-to-CPU data transfers that were constrained on Gen 4 platforms have headroom here, and future Gen 5 accelerators won't require a platform upgrade to reach full speed.
  • PCIe 5.0 M.2 Storage: The onboard PCIe 5.0 M.2 slot means Gen 5 NVMe drives can run at their rated sequential speeds without being throttled by the interface. For workloads that stream large assets — raw video, point cloud data, ML checkpoints — storage I/O bandwidth matters as much as compute.
  • 36 Power Stages: A 36-stage power delivery system provides the current headroom that high-TDP Threadripper PRO processors demand under sustained all-core loads. Inadequate VRM staging causes thermal throttling under sustained load — this power delivery design is sized for the CPU platform it supports.
  • WiFi 7 (802.11be): WiFi 7 supports multi-link operation and up to 46 Gbps theoretical throughput — meaningfully faster than WiFi 6E in congested environments. For a workstation that pulls large files from NAS or connects to a high-density wireless segment, WiFi 7 avoids the wireless connection becoming the bottleneck.
  • 10 Gb + 2.5 Gb Dual LAN: Dual onboard LAN covers two common enterprise wiring scenarios simultaneously — 10GbE for primary high-throughput connectivity (NAS, backbone switches) and 2.5GbE as a secondary or management port. No add-in NIC required for either tier.
  • RAID 0, 1, 5, 10 Support: Onboard RAID across up to 7 storage devices (4 HDD + M.2 + SATA) gives you flexibility to configure redundancy or striping at the storage layer without a separate RAID card — useful in workstations where drive failure tolerance matters but a dedicated HBA isn't warranted.
  • Multi-GPU Support: The board is explicitly validated for multi-GPU configurations, which is relevant for rendering pipelines, ML training rigs, and GPU-accelerated inference deployments where a single GPU's VRAM or compute throughput isn't sufficient.
  • No On-Board Graphics: There is no integrated GPU. A discrete GPU is required for display output — plan accordingly when speccing the full system. This is standard for workstation-class platforms where discrete graphics are assumed.

Integration & Compatibility

The P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I targets the AMD Ryzen Threadripper PRO 7000 WX-Series exclusively via Socket sTR5 — verify your CPU is a WX-Series part before ordering, as the sTR5 socket is not backward-compatible with earlier Threadripper generations. DDR5 ECC R-DIMM is the required memory type; standard DDR5 UDIMM modules are not supported on this platform. With support for workstation motherboards in the ASUS Pro WS line, the P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I fits within a broader ecosystem of ASUS professional-grade components. Storage flexibility spans M.2 NVMe (including Gen 5) and up to four SATA III HDDs or SSDs, with RAID 0/1/5/10 configurable across up to seven drives total. USB connectivity includes two USB 2.0 headers and one USB 3.2 Gen 1 connector — plan your front-panel I/O against these counts when selecting a workstation chassis. The CEB form factor is compatible with CEB and extended-ATX chassis; confirm case clearance before finalizing your build. Dual LAN (10GbE + 2.5GbE) integrates directly with managed network switches supporting those speeds without requiring an add-in card.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Which AMD processors are compatible with the ASUS P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I?

A: The P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I uses Socket sTR5 and is designed for AMD Ryzen Threadripper PRO 7000 WX-Series processors. It is not compatible with earlier Threadripper generations or consumer Ryzen CPUs.

Q: What type of memory does the P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I require?

A: The board requires DDR5 ECC R-DIMM modules across four DIMM slots in quad-channel configuration, supporting up to 1 TB total. Standard DDR5 UDIMM is not supported on this platform.

Q: Does the P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I have onboard graphics?

A: No. The P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I does not include integrated graphics. A discrete GPU is required for display output.

Q: How many storage devices can the P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I support?

A: The board supports up to 7 storage drives total — up to 4 HDDs via SATA III, plus M.2 and additional SATA-connected SSDs. RAID 0, 1, 5, and 10 are supported across these drives.

Q: What are the networking options on the P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I?

A: The board includes dual onboard LAN — 10 Gigabit Ethernet and 2.5 Gigabit Ethernet — plus WiFi 7 (802.11be) for wireless connectivity. No add-in NIC is required for either wired tier.

Q: What chassis form factor does the P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I require?

A: The P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I uses the CEB form factor, which is compatible with CEB and most Extended-ATX chassis. Verify case dimensions and standoff placement before building.

The P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I is a purpose-built professional workstation platform — not a consumer board with a workstation badge. The combination of Socket sTR5, quad-channel DDR5 ECC R-DIMM support up to 1 TB, and a 36-stage power delivery system makes it one of the few boards that can actually sustain a high-TDP Threadripper PRO 7000 WX CPU under all-core workloads without thermal throttling becoming the story.

Technical Highlights:

  • 1 TB ECC DDR5 ceiling: Four DIMM slots in quad-channel DDR5 with ECC R-DIMM support up to 1 TB — enough addressable memory to hold very large in-memory datasets without swapping, and ECC ensures that a single-bit error doesn't silently corrupt a compute result mid-run.
  • PCIe 5.0 on both x16 and M.2: Running Gen 5 on both the expansion slot and the M.2 interface means neither a current-gen GPU nor a Gen 5 NVMe drive will be throttled by the platform — relevant when you're running sequential reads from storage directly into GPU memory for inference or rendering pipelines.
  • Dual LAN — 10GbE + 2.5GbE: Having both ports onboard without an add-in card keeps a PCIe lane free for compute. In practice, the 10GbE handles NAS or backbone connectivity and the 2.5GbE handles management or secondary traffic — clean separation without a slot penalty.

Deployment Considerations:

  • The CEB form factor requires explicit chassis verification — not every tower or rack workstation case that accepts E-ATX will correctly position CEB standoffs. Confirm motherboard tray compatibility before ordering a chassis separately.
  • No onboard graphics means the system won't POST to a display without a discrete GPU installed — factor this into deployment sequencing when provisioning the machine remotely or in a headless build environment where a GPU isn't the first component installed.

The PROWSTRX50-SAGEWIFI is the right call for a dedicated multi-GPU workstation node — specifically rendering farms, large-model fine-tuning rigs, or simulation workstations where 1 TB ECC memory and sustained all-core CPU throughput are actual requirements, not aspirational specs.
